Colorado is known for its vast amount of outdoor activities, and during the warmer parts of the year white water rafting is a major draw for both tourists and residents. The Arkansas River runs through a large part of Colorado, and there are many different river rafting trips that it has to offer. Some of the more popular white water rafting trips include, The Numbers, Browns Canyon, The Royal Gorge Canyon, and Bighorn Sheep Canyon. All of these Colorado rafting trips attract people from all over, and are known for different levels of intensity.
The Numbers is a part of the Arkansas River where white water rafting is taken to the advanced level. This trip takes you along some of the wildest rapids found in this river, and entails steep drop- offs, narrow passageways, and strong paddling skills. Because The Numbers is one of the less tame parts of this river, people looking for a calm ride should not partake. Bookings with professionals can be made to make this trip, and it is suggested that a person choose an experienced rafting company when deciding upon this adventure.
Royal Gorge rafting is classified as an intermediate to advanced rafting trip. This excursion is slightly less difficult when compared to The Numbers, yet it still provides large rapids and a lot of white water. The main attraction to this rafting trip is contributed to the bridge that will pass over you head. The Royal Gorge Bridge stands over 1,000 ft overhead and is the largest suspension bridge in the world, leaving you in awe. This rafting trip is one of the most popular, and its mix of beauty and excitement are the main reasons why.
Both Brown’s Canyon and Bighorn Sheep Canyon are trips that the entire family can enjoy, and provide both breathtaking views and stimulating whitewater rapids. These trips are recognized as beginner to intermediate in roughness, which allows people of every kind to enjoy. Brown’s Canyon is known for being an even balance between rushing rapids and calm, beautiful views. The Bighorn Sheep Canyon rafting was named after its usual sighting of wildlife along the mountainside. Both trips provide beauty and excitement, and can be best experienced when a professional rafting guide conducts you through.
